    Oddly enough I found this movie by chance.

    I don't think it could be cornier if it tried. Yet that is it's charm. It blatant Indiana Jones clone, but a very good one. Full of adventure, mystery and cheezy performances. Yet allot of fun and worth a chance.

    Overall:
    A fun movie that as long as you don't take it seriously, you'll have a blast. A guilty pleasure at the least.

His deadpan delivery, which he's perfected, just brings such a casual approach to the most menacing predicaments that you can't help but smile. The main "theme" music just has such a goofy lilt to it (and for some reason, reminds me of the "Benny Hill" theme) that it draws you along gracefully. Granted, as some others have noted, this is "Indiana Jones" on the cheap. But it strikes me that it was made with tongue firmly in cheek. The humor isn't forced, and helps to remind the viewer that this isn't your dead-serious "save the world" epic. I'd recommend it for casual viewing. Full Review »
